How do you paint over wallpaper border?
Apply Primer However, when you are painting over wallpaper borders, make sure you apply a coat of primer. Apply it thinly and evenly at first, paying careful attention to problem areas. The best way to apply primer is with a roller for general coverage, and then a brush to target specific problem areas.
Is painting over wallpaper a bad idea?
Painting over wallpaper can look really bad. If you have long edges of wallpaper unrolling or air bubbles beneath the surface, you will be better off removing it completely. But if not, with a little wallpaper preparation and a few tricks, you can be left with a finished result that you’re happy with.
What primer Do you need to paint over wallpaper border?
Next up on the list of How to Paint Over Wallpaper is to apply a high-quality oil-based primer to all of the walls. The primer helps seal the adhesive in the paper and prevents the moisture from paint from loosening wallpaper glue, causing bubbles, and peeling.

Can you put a wallpaper border over another border?
You CAN put new border over old or any other wall paper BUT you must use a special VOV paste( vinyl over vinyl) nothing else will stick to the original vinyl paper properly.

How do you remove a border from wallpaper?
Mix equal parts water and fabric softener in a spray bottle, shake and spray onto the wallpaper. Allow the solution to penetrate the border for 5-10 minutes before attempting to scrape it off with a putty knife or scraper.
What can I use to paint over wallpaper?
You’ll want to use an oil-based primer over the wallpaper before you paint. Oil-based primers can take longer to dry and the smell will be overbearing, but there are now some fast drying options available. “Oil-based primer will block anything coming through,” Snyder says.

What is the best paint for covering wallpaper?
The alternative is to paint over wallpaper. However, it’s imperative you carefully prepare the surface. Oil-based primer or priming shellac covers the pattern and seals the paper against moisture to keep the paper from bubbling and the glue from loosening underneath new paint.
Can you paint over textured walls?
Semigloss paint is generally preferred over a flat type for painting textured walls. This is because the consistency of the paint tends to penetrate the grooves of the wall better. Flat paint also tends to soak into the surface, which in turn requires more product to be used.

What is a wallpaper border?
Wallpaper borders are a true wallpaper product, but they differ from regular wallpaper in the manner in which they are installed and their relative size. Traditional wallpaper is hung vertically from the ceiling to the floor. Wallpaper borders are hung horizontally.
